The College Football Playoff National Championship is scheduled to take place on January 19, 2026, 7PM ET.
This market will resolve to "Yes" if either a play-by-play announcer or a color commentator says the listed term at any point between kickoff and the conclusion of this game during its official broadcast. Otherwise, the market will resolve to "No".
Any usage of the term regardless of context will count toward the resolution of this market.
Plural or possessive versions of the listed term will count toward the resolution of this market, regardless of the context of their use.
Instances where the term is used in a compound word will count regardless of context (e.g. joyful is not a compound word for "joy," however "killjoy" is a compounding of the words "kill" and "joy").
If this market requires a specified number of mentions of a person’s first or last name, a full-name mention will count as one mention (e.g., if a market is about “Joe / Biden 5+ times,” a mention of “Joe Biden” will count once).
If the start of this game is cancelled or otherwise delayed beyond January 31, 2026, 11:59 PM ET this market will resolve to "No".
AI-generated content will not count towards the resolution of this market.
The resolution source for this market is the official ESPN broadcast of this game.
